Key Takeaways from the Interview
Saving remains a priority—but it’s challenging:~52% of Americans say saving is a top priority~72% say inflation and cost of living are impacting financesAutomation is one of the easiest wins:Tools like debit round-ups (e.g., “Keep the Change”)Recurring automatic transfers to “pay yourself first”Balance saving with lifestyle (don’t eliminate joy spending):Cut back—not cut out—small treatsIdentify “joy spending” categories and prioritize intentionallyUse the 50/30/20 framework:50% needs30% wants20% savingsMake big goals more achievable:Break savings goals into smaller milestonesSet deadlines and celebrate progressUse separate accounts for specific goals (reduces temptation)Free up extra cash with small adjustments:Review subscriptionsReduce unnecessary spending (rideshare, etc.)Small changes can compound over timeHelpful resources mentioned:America Saves WeekBetterMoneyHabits.comBank of America Life Plan toolsSchedule your free financial consultation at TakePrideInRetirement.com or call 855-246-9211.
